With auto insurance rates always on the increase, hopefully the information here may help to find a lower quotation. There are many different types of auto insurance coverage to choose from, depending on what you want covered and what you can afford. Auto insurance policies are made up of many parts, reflected in the type of accidents that happen including; injuring another road user or pedestrian, damage to property or another vehicle, collision with an uninsured or underinsured driver and fully comprehensive insurance.
Before the advent of the internet, getting realistic quotes from auto insurance companies was difficult if not at times, almost impossible. Now, some online sites will actually compare the car insurance rates from several auto insurance companies for you so that you can see at a glance which one would be best suited for your needs. Searching online for your auto insurance could save you a huge amount of money and a considerable amount of time in the process.
To make matters worse, the cost of your auto insurance can be based on many different aspects including where you live, where the car is parked, how much power the car has and even the cost of repairs. It's a pretty safe bet though that you'll pay more for your auto insurance policy if you live in a big city when compared to a nice farm out in the country. Although your auto insurance will certainly add a considerable amount to your annual budget, most good companies will be able to set up a monthly repayment plan to help.
Experts advise that you should always ask for free quotes on auto insurance from different insurance agents well before your present insurance expires. For some individuals, giving up their fast, high risk vehicle might be necessary as the comprehensive auto insurance premiums can be very high unless they decide to go with a more basic insurance plan. The advantage of having a comprehensive insurance plan though is that the insurance company will pay for any medical bills and time lost from work even if the accident was their fault. In addition to these, passengers in both vehicles, although not blood relations, are covered by this type of insurance plan.
When you switch is very important and the best time to switch to a new auto insurance company is when the current policy is about to expire. Before you do finally cancel your existing auto insurance, it would be prudent to confirm that the new insurance provider has accepted your application. Some companies also give a discount if you decide to have your home insured with them in addition to your vehicle insurance; so it is worth checking this out in advance. Often just a few simple pieces of advice like this can help the seasoned driver as well as the novice driver save some time and money when searching for their auto insurance.
